Devotion

By Amreen Fatima


Devotion is an intense emotion. For ages, it has been used to civilize people to make them the way they are now. When a person gets devoted to something or to someone, he or she will do every possible thing to make that something in its best way or to make that person to whom he or she is devoted the happiest person.

Thus, we can divide the Devotion into different categories:


  1. Devotion towards work or any non-living things

A devoted person under his legal limits will always remain self-motivated. For example, if a person is devoted to his work, he/she will ensure that his work gets completed on time and with the best quality. That, in turn, would motivate him to do it on time and put his/her 100 percent effort into it.

He/she will also make sure that nothing comes onto their reputation. So, they will abide by the rules. That is also a positive element making a person a better human and more civilized.


  1. Devotion towards supernatural power or any religion or faith

If a person is devoted to any supernatural power or say to his/her religion. That is the most positive thing happening because, at that time, he/she would automatically become the best version of themselves as no religion in this world preaches terrible habits or lousy etiquette.



  1. Devotion towards another human being or living thing

When a person is devoted to fellowmen or other living things of the world, they will try their best to make that person or living things (animals or plants) happy and healthy and ensure that nothing harms them.


But what if this Devotion crosses limits?

Yes, being devotional is always considered a positive attitude, but it too has its negative attribute. When a person gets too devoted to anything or work, he/she will stop caring about other things, which might make them workaholics or sick or cut them out of their friends' circle or destroy their relationships, and the good thing is that they don't even realize about it.

And if a person is too devoted to his own religion /faith /supernatural power, he/she is likely to become orthodox or less tolerant of others' religion/belief, which in turn seeds communal disturbance and hatred in the long ru

Lastly, when a person gets too devoted to other living being, he /she is likely to become selfish to make that living being happy and will not bother about any other emotion.


Thus, we can conclude that Devotion is an exceptionally positive attitude that helps make any individual self-motivated, caring, punctual, practical, lovable, and self-disciplined but being too Devotional towards anything or anyone might invite a bundle of negative attitudes along like self - centered, possessiveness, orthodoxy and intolerance.
